Max Fried Has No Timetable For Return
Atlanta Braves starting pitcher Max Fried (hamstring) was cleared to throw a side session and complete some fielding drills on Friday, but there is no timetable for his return. Diamondbacks-Braves Game Saturday Postponed
The Arizona Diamondbacks-Atlanta Braves game scheduled for Saturday night has been postponed due to inclement weather, according to Nick Piecoro of the Arizona Republic. The game will be made up on Sunday as part of a doubleheader, with Game 1 set to start at 1:20 p.m. Make sure to adjust lineups accordingly this weekend.
